Lieutenant Michael Hoosock of the Onondaga County (NY) Sheriff’s Office and Officer Michael Jensen of the Syracuse (NY) Police Department, were shot and killed in the line of duty on the night of Sunday, April 14th, 2024.  

Lt. Hoosock was a beloved deputy, husband, father and a highly respected lifetime member (and past Deputy Chief) of the Moyer’s Corner Fire Department. He leaves behind his loving family, beautiful wife, Caitlin, and there three young children, ages 7, 5 & 3. 

Officer Jensen was a member of the Syracuse  Police Department since February of 2022 and had recently been awarded “Officer of the Month” in December of 2023. A Syracuse resident, Officer Jensen leaves behind his loving parents and sister.
